How to increase your chances

Choose applications with a stronger fit

  • Prioritize scholarships that match your specific healthcare path, such as nursing, pre-med, public health, or allied health.
  • Prepare service, clinical, research, or volunteer examples before you start scholarship essays.
  • Check whether each provider requires enrollment in an accredited program, a minimum GPA, or proof of healthcare-related goals.
  • Apply early when recommendation letters, transcripts, or program verification may be required.

Frequently asked questions about medicine scholarships

Who can apply for medicine and healthcare scholarships?
Eligibility depends on the scholarship provider. Some awards are open to broad healthcare majors, while others focus on nursing, pre-med, public health, pharmacy, therapy, allied health, or biomedical science. Many providers also consider school level, GPA, financial need, community service, location, or whether you are enrolled in an accredited program.
How should I choose which medical scholarships to apply for?
Start with scholarships where you meet most of the stated eligibility signals, including field of study, school level, GPA, location, and required materials. Then compare deadlines and effort level. A smaller, more specific healthcare scholarship can be a better use of time than a broad award if your background clearly matches the provider criteria.
What materials do medical scholarship applications often require?
Common requirements include a short essay, transcript, resume, recommendation letter, proof of enrollment, and details about healthcare career goals. Some scholarships may ask about clinical exposure, volunteering, research, leadership, or service to underserved communities. Always confirm the official provider requirements before submitting.
